Generate matching structure for configuration classes
This commit improves GeneratedClass to support inner classes, allowing them to be registered by name with a type customizer, as GeneratedClasses does for top level classes. BeanDefinitionMethodGenerator leverages this feature to create a matching structure for configuration classes that contain inner classes. Closes gh-29213
